Understanding Pompano Beach Market with Detailed AirDNA Data

Before diving into the world of Airbnb hosting, it’s crucial to understand the local market dynamics in Pompano Beach. Known for its beautiful beaches and vibrant outdoor activities, including fishing, boating, and diving, Pompano Beach attracts a diverse array of visitors. The city’s attractiveness is magnified during the winter and early spring months, when the harsh climates of the north drive tourists towards warmer destinations, leading to a significant increase in rental demand.

  • Average Daily Rate (ADR): $303.6
  • Maximum Daily Rate: $353 in March
  • Occupancy Rate: Average 57%
  • Maximum Occupancy Rate: 75% in February
  • Maximum Monthly Revenue: $6,000 in March
  • Number of Active Rentals: 2,585
  • Average Annual Revenue: Approximately $49.5K
  • Revenue Per Available Room (RevPAR): $174.4
  • Weekend RevPAR: $311
  • Best Month for Revenue: February
  • Submarket Score: 75
  • Population of Pompano Beach, Florida: 112,650
  • Average Home Value: $366,560

To capitalize on this opportunity, having a granular understanding of the market through AirDNA data is invaluable. Here are some critical metrics for Airbnb hosts in Pompano Beach:

Average Daily Rate (ADR): The ADR stands at $303.6, with the maximum daily rate reaching up to $353 in March. This indicates a potentially higher earning period during the early spring.

Occupancy Rate: The average occupancy rate hovers around 57%, with the peak at 75% in February. This peak suggests that February is the optimal month for maximizing occupancy.

Revenue Metrics: The maximum monthly revenue recorded in March is approximately $6,000. Across all active rentals, the average annual revenue is about $49.5K, highlighting the profitability of the market.

Revenue Per Available Room (RevPAR): The RevPAR is $174.4, which jumps significantly on weekends to $311, emphasizing the higher demand during these days.

Market Size and Competitiveness: With 2,585 active rentals, the market is competitive yet substantial, offering numerous opportunities for new entrants. The submarket score of 75 points indicates a healthy and viable environment for Airbnb rentals.

Demographics and Property Values: Pompano Beach has a population of 112,650. The average home value is $366,560, which has seen a 4.9% increase over the past year, indicating a healthy real estate market that supports short-term rental investments.

Navigating Regulatory Compliance and Local Ordinances for Short-Term Rentals in Pompano Beach

Maintaining compliance with local regulations is essential for operating a successful Airbnb in Pompano Beach. The city has established specific guidelines and requirements for short-term rentals to ensure that both hosts and guests enjoy a safe, reliable, and professional experience. Understanding and adhering to these regulations not only helps in avoiding penalties but also enhances your credibility as a host.

City Code of Ordinances

Pompano Beach permits short-term rentals under strict conditions. A short-term rental is defined as any residential unit rented for six months or less in a calendar year, whether advertised on platforms like Airbnb, VRBO, or similar. Property owners looking to engage in this type of rental must secure an annual permit for properties including single-family homes, duplexes, triplexes, or quadplexes. Detailed information and specific codes can be found under Chapter 153 – Rental Housing Code of the Pompano Beach Code of Ordinances.

Building and Housing Standards

Pompano Beach enforces regulations concerning building design, maintenance standards, and safety. These rules aim to maintain the habitability and safety of short-term rental properties. Operators should refer to Chapter 153.26 of the Pompano Beach Code of Ordinances for minimum standards and contact the Building Inspections Department to ensure compliance.

Occupancy Standards

The city imposes specific occupancy limitations:

  • Occupancy is capped at two persons per bedroom.
  • Overall occupancy must not exceed limits set by the property’s zoning district.

These standards are in place to prevent overuse and maintain neighborhood tranquility.

Tourist and Local Taxes

Hosts are required to register with the Broward County Tax Collector to collect and remit Tourism Development taxes, sales surtaxes, and transient rental taxes. Evidence of an active account for managing these taxes must be kept up-to-date and compliant with local tax laws.

Additional Compliance Considerations

Hosts must ensure that their operation does not disturb the local community. The city may revoke a rental’s annual license for reasons such as:

  • Misstatements on the application.
  • Repeated parking violations.
  • Noise disturbances.
  • Persistent issues with littering and other code violations.

It’s also crucial to respect any additional agreements, such as leases, condo board rules, HOA regulations, or any other organizational rules that might affect your ability to host.

Strategic Pricing Techniques for Maximizing Airbnb Profitability in Pompano Beach

Effective pricing strategies are critical for optimizing the profitability of your Airbnb listing in Pompano Beach. Here’s how you can use dynamic pricing tools and local market insights to set competitive and profitable rates:

Utilizing Dynamic Pricing Tools

Airbnb Smart Pricing: This tool automatically adjusts your nightly rate based on changes in demand and supply within the local area. Enable Smart Pricing on your listing to ensure your prices are competitive while maximizing your potential income. You can set minimum and maximum limits to maintain control over your rates.

Third-Party Pricing Apps: Consider using additional dynamic pricing tools like Hosty, Beyond Pricing, or Pricelabs. These platforms analyze broader data sets, including market trends, local events, and even weather patterns, to optimize your pricing strategy further.

Monitoring Local Events and Seasons

Calendar of Local Events: Keep an updated calendar of local events in Pompano Beach, such as festivals, concerts, sports events, and conventions. Events can significantly increase demand for accommodations, allowing you to adjust prices accordingly.

Understand Seasonal Trends: Pompano Beach experiences fluctuations in tourist traffic with the seasons. For instance, the winter months see a surge in visitors escaping colder climates. Adjust your rates during these peak times to reflect the higher demand.

Weekend and Holiday Pricing: Typically, weekends and holidays experience higher demand. Adjust your rates to reflect this increased interest. Charging more during these periods is a common practice and can significantly boost your revenue.

Competitive Analysis

Study Competitors: Regularly check the pricing of other Airbnb listings in your area. Note what amenities they offer at their price point and how they adjust prices for different times of the year. This insight will help you stay competitive without undercutting your profitability.

Feedback and Occupancy Rates: Use feedback from guests and occupancy rates to gauge if your pricing is appropriate. If you’re booked solid months in advance, it might be a sign you could increase your prices. Conversely, low occupancy might suggest the need for a price adjustment or added value.

Responsive Pricing Adjustments

Last-Minute Deals: If you find yourself with unbooked dates, consider offering last-minute deals to attract spontaneous travelers. These should be priced lower than your usual rate but can help fill gaps in your calendar.

Long-Term Stays: Offering discounts for longer stays can attract guests who contribute stable income and reduce turnover costs. This is particularly appealing during off-peak seasons.

Early Bird Specials: Encourage early bookings by offering discounts for reservations made well in advance. This not only secures your income earlier but also helps in planning your financial year.

Implementing Sustainability Practices in Your Pompano Beach Airbnb

Incorporating sustainable practices into your Airbnb operation can significantly enhance its appeal to eco-conscious travelers while also helping to reduce operational costs. For Airbnb hosts in Pompano Beach, focusing on sustainability is not only a moral decision but a strategic one, as it can set your listing apart and make it more attractive to a broad audience. Here’s how you can integrate green practices into your property management:

Energy Efficiency

Energy-Efficient Appliances: Replace older models of refrigerators, dishwashers, washers, and dryers with energy-efficient ones that have a high Energy Star rating. These appliances consume less electricity and water, reducing your utility bills and environmental footprint.

LED Lighting: Switch to LED bulbs throughout the property. LEDs are more energy-efficient than traditional bulbs and have a longer lifespan, which means less waste and lower energy usage.

Smart Thermostats: Install smart thermostats to better control heating and cooling in your property. These devices adjust the temperature based on whether someone is at home and the time of day, which can significantly reduce unnecessary energy consumption.

Water Conservation

Low-Flow Fixtures: Install low-flow showerheads, faucets, and toilets to reduce water use. These fixtures can significantly decrease water consumption without compromising performance, which is particularly important in areas like Pompano Beach, where water conservation is essential.

Native Landscaping: Consider xeriscaping or using native plants in your garden. These plants require less water and maintenance than non-native varieties, reducing the need for irrigation and chemical fertilizers.

Solar Energy

Solar Panels: Installing solar panels is an excellent way to reduce dependence on fossil fuels. Solar energy can power your property’s electricity, heating, and even hot water systems. Initial installation costs are offset by the long-term savings on energy bills.

Sustainable Supplies

Eco-Friendly Cleaning Products: Use environmentally friendly cleaning agents for maintaining your property. These products are less harmful to the environment and are a subtle yet effective way to demonstrate your commitment to sustainability.

Recycled and Sustainable Materials: When updating or furnishing your Airbnb, choose materials and products made from recycled or sustainably sourced materials. This could include anything from furniture to bed linens and towels.

Waste Reduction

Recycling and Composting Bins: Provide clearly labeled recycling bins for guests to use, and if possible, set up a compost bin for organic waste. This helps reduce the overall waste associated with your rental.

Reusable Items: Equip your kitchen with reusable items such as cloth napkins, sponges, and glass water bottles instead of disposable paper goods and plastic bottles. This not only cuts down on waste but also enhances the guest experience with high-quality, durable products.

Guest Involvement

Encourage Eco-Friendly Practices: In your welcome book, include a section encouraging guests to participate in your sustainability efforts. Offer tips on how to conserve energy and water during their stay and share information about local recycling rules.
